On Monday, May 1, 2023, Ikumi Keita <ik...@ikumi.que.jp> wrote: > Hi Hongyi, > > >>>>> Hongyi Zhao <hongyi.z...@gmail.com> writes: > > I noticed the following auto-generated LaTeX comment code at the end > > of my file: > > > %%% Local Variables: > > %%% mode: latex > > %%% TeX-master: t > > %%% TeX-master: t > > %%% End: > > > But I want to know why there are two duplicate lines, aka, "%%% > > TeX-master: t"? > > The information you provided is too little to answer :-). In general, > AUCTeX pays attention not to do so. If `TeX-add-local-master' is called > in the buffer for some reason, such duplication will appear. However, > `TeX-add-local-master' is called only in `TeX-master-file-ask' in AUCTeX > source, and `TeX-master-file-ask' calls `TeX-add-local-master' only when > there isn't "%%% TeX-master:" line yet. > So I don't know why such duplication occured. (Maybe some 3rd party code > calls `TeX-add-local-master'?)
